Ditch clearing services involve the removal of accumulated debris, overgrown vegetation, and obstructions from drainage ditches, streams, or other water management features on a property. This process typically includes the use of specialized equipment to efficiently remove silt, leaves, branches, and other debris that can block water flow. Clearing these areas helps ensure that water can drain properly, reducing the risk of flooding, erosion, and water damage. Property owners who notice excessive buildup or blockages in their drainage channels may find ditch clearing to be an essential part of maintaining the safety and functionality of their land.

Over time, ditches and water channels can become clogged with debris due to seasonal storms, nearby tree growth, or general neglect. When these obstructions occur, they can cause water to back up, leading to pooling and potential flooding during heavy rains. Ditch clearing services address these issues by restoring unobstructed water flow, which is crucial for protecting landscapes, foundations, and other structures on a property. Regular maintenance can prevent more extensive problems from developing, making ditch clearing an important step in overall property upkeep, especially in areas prone to frequent or heavy rainfall.

Properties that often benefit from ditch clearing include residential lots with drainage ditches, farmland, commercial properties with stormwater management systems, and properties near streams or waterways. Homeowners with large yards or properties situated on slopes may also need this service to prevent water from pooling around foundations or creating erosion issues. Farm owners and land managers frequently use ditch clearing to maintain irrigation channels and prevent waterlogging. In many cases, rural or semi-rural properties experience more frequent need for this work due to natural debris buildup and the topography of the land.

The overview below groups typical Ditch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oakland,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Ditch Clearing Jobs - Typical costs for routine ditch clearing projects in Oakland range from $250 to $600. Many smaller jobs fall within this range, covering basic debris removal and minor vegetation control.

Medium-Sized Projects - For more extensive ditch clearing involving moderate vegetation and debris,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for suburban properties with more overgrowth.

Larger or Complex Jobs - Larger projects, such as clearing heavily overgrown ditches or those requiring equipment rental, can cost between $1,200 and $3,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ving significant site preparation.

Full Replacement or Major Repairs - Complete ditch reconstruction or major repairs can exceed $5,000, though such jobs are less frequent and depend heavily on the scope and complexity of the work invol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
